This document discusses the Parable of the Prodigal Son from the perspective of the father. It describes how the younger son asks for his inheritance early and wastes it through riotous living, until he returns home poor and the father welcomes him back with open arms. The document provides lessons for Father's Day, including that fathers should teach values through their words and actions, be responsible for raising children in the Lord, remember redemption is a process, and show complete forgiveness.
